Seasonal premium RV/MotorHome catch 22 Beware of annual scam.

We had been a Farm Bureau dedicated customer for nearly 10 years and paid them a LOT of money along the way with no claims.  Recently, our original agent left and we were transferred to another agent without any contact and only found out after making some changes to our policy.

Shortly after, we noticed some unusual changes in our billing - up, then down, then continued billing for things we canceled.  After contacting the new agent, and getting the run around, we were told 5 different stories as to why the changes all took place and there was a LOT of confusion (maybe one of the tricks used to daze customers).  Ultimately we said "Well if we can't fix this we may have to cancel all of our policies" the response "Good luck with that" And were never told that if we canceled we would owe over $1000

So we canceled our policies and found that there is a small sentence in the documentation - not the contract (Farm Bureau has not been able to produce the actual contract) The sentence relates to MotorHomes and seasonal premiums, which means that FB will not credit any canceled premiums owed - even if you cancel due to their complete and total incompetence.

I asked "So we can't cancel the contract - even for cause"  The answer "NO!"

This internally leaked email from Lisa Fairbanks Farm Bureau Agency Manager in Gilbert Arizona indicates the way Farm Bureau thinks of their customers:

"no matter how hard we try we can’t satisfy the client"  Now there's a true statement!

Read the document and NEVER commit to any annual seasonal premium.

We changed to another company (All State) and saved 30% for the exact same policies and no annual clause

It certainly doesn't pay to be a loyal long term customer.  What a RIP OFF
